Her Majesty The Queen has been a reining favorite and consistently
gets high approval ratings by her subjects in her kingdom.
The Queen remains gracefully hidden, and has never given a press interview.
Her style is monochromatic 100%.
Monochromatic is boring you say?
Challenge that idea by looking at history and seeing how monochromatic
clothing has stood the test of time and still looks fresh.

The Queen is well known for wearing overcoats with matching hats
that allow her to been seen easily in a crowd.
She skillfully uses one color to stand out above the rest of her subjects.
I can't help but get inspired by monochromatic consistency that obviously works for a lifetime.
